i really like the range of adjustability on the Meridian. the drawback, though, is that i'd need to learn how to make it do the stuff i want rather than having handy presets. it's one thing to craft yourself a Leslie sound you can dial back in, another entirely to flip a knob to "ROTARY." there's a remarkable range of control here, though.

i've gone back and listened to everything again after a couple of days to forget what i think i know. several otherwise-great options won't work for me because they don't flange. it's down to the Empress or the ALABS. the ALABS is superficially "prettier" while the Empress has a more uncolored sound that might sit better in a mix. i have to listen to yet more demos. sigh.
